This solution uses a Google Cloud aggregated log sink at the organization level combined with least-privilege IAM permissions and regional Cloud Storage configuration to deliver a centralized, secure, and compliant log repository.
--include-children flag guarantees that all current and future child folders and projects automatically export their audit logs without requiring manual sink deployment per project.europe-west3 in a dedicated logging project guarantees that log archives remain stored within the mandated regulatory boundaries.roles/storage.objectCreator ensures write-only access—the writer identity can upload (storage.objects.create) new log objects but cannot read, overwrite, or delete existing log entries. Furthermore, centralizing storage in a restricted security project isolates logs from child project administrators.roles/storage.objectCreator role prevents log exfiltration (no read permissions) and log tampering (no overwrite or delete permissions).This architecture satisfies all compliance and isolation requirements by leveraging native GCP aggregated log sinks and atomic IAM role assignments, eliminating administrative overhead while enforcing strict data residency and write-only integrity.
